US Seizes Venezuela Oil Tanker, Escalating Maritime Crackdown

The United States has seized an oil tanker that recently departed from Venezuela, marking the second such interception this month as Washington escalates enforcement against what it describes as illicit Venezuelan oil shipments.

The operation was carried out by the U.S. Coast Guard in international waters and follows President Donald Trump’s announcement this week that the U.S. would impose a maritime “blockade” on oil tankers entering or leaving Venezuela in violation of American sanctions.
